Anaso Jobodwana is a 100m & 200m sprinter who will go to Rio carrying the hopes of many Citizens in this country , chanting for him to bring back a medal or two.

Jobodwana is not new to the track scene - having competed at the London Olympics in 2012 and most recently made his name when he finished third at the IAAF World Championships in Beijing in 2015 behind Justin Gatlin and The one and only Usain Bolt .
